About This Book

What would you do if your family caught a giant whale? Amiqqaq’s heart races with excitement as preparations begin for the special Iñupiaq whaling feast. But there’s more to this whale than meets the eye—what secret does the spirit-of-the-whale hold?

Quick Assessment

Whale Snow is a gentle fiction story aimed at early readers ages 5 to 8, introducing them to Iñupiaq culture and traditions surrounding the bowhead whale harvest. The book explores themes of family, community, and respect for nature through Amiqqaq’s experience with the traditional whaling feast. It is appropriate for young children and provides cultural insight without intense conflict or mature content.
